Ridgway is located at the junction of Highways 550 and 62, in Southwest Colorado, Gateway to the beautiful San Juan Mountains. Montrose, Ouray and Telluride are just a few miles from Ridgway. We are an important town on the San Juan Scenic Highway, the most beautiful and popular tourist route in Colorado.
In it's 38th year, the Ridgway Rendezvous offers both artists and patrons a well organized, quality show. We are known for one of the most picturesque locations for booth set-up and for shoppers in our spacious town park and for successful sales for our vendors. The Rendezvous is a juried show with a commitment to quality.
The show is attended by several thousand customers and is hailed by many of our regular participants as “one of their best shows of the year”. The organizers offer live musical entertainment all day both days of the show and several attractions are geared specifically to children. The event is fun for the whole family and there is no admission charge. We hope to see you this summer!
The Ridgway Rendezvous Arts and Crafts Festival is hosted and sponsored by Weehawken Creative Art. Funds raised at this event help support Weehawken Creative Arts Youth Art Programs. The Ridgway Rendezvous is Weehawken's largest annual fundraising event.
